Can My Friend or Family Member Drive the U-Haul? The person renting the truck is responsible for any potential damage it may receive during the time of use. There is no policy against the renter having another person drive the rental, but this is a liability that the driver should not take lightly.

Large Dining Room Tables-- Normal sized dining room tables may simply be wrapped and also secured as is. Yet, if you have a huge, hefty dining-room table, the moving companies will likely remove the legs and also shield every little thing separately. Because it's simpler to pack it in the vehicle if the legs are off, this maintains the legs and dining space table from damaging throughout transportation. How much does U-Haul Moving Help cost? U-Haul Moving Help costs about $45 per hour for most services with a two-hour minimum. The average price for other help-for-hire companies is nearly $85 per hour—a savings of $40 per hour per worker.

The cost of hiring two men and a truck to move you less than a hundred miles is between $80-$100/hour. The total cost will depend on how big your house is. For out-of-state moves or moves over 100 miles away, the cost for two men and a truck is between $2000-$5000 per load plus $. 50 per pound.
